Hi, everyone! Welcome to Cantonese Weekly Words. Today, we’re going to talk about post office, 郵局 (jau4 guk2) “post office”. Let’s see what are the words. |
1. 郵局 (jau4 guk2) “post office” |
我去郵局寄信。 (ngo5 heoi3 jau4 guk2 gei3 seon3.) “I go to the post office to mail a letter.” |
歐洲啲郵局好靚。 (au1 zau1 di1 jau4 guk2 hou2 leng3.) “Post offices in Europe are very beautiful.” |
They’re usually in old buildings. |
And the next word is… |
2. 郵票 (jau4 piu3) “stamp” |
You lick the stamp and put it on the postcard or envelope. |
我細個有儲郵票。 (ngo5 sai3 go3 jau5 cou5 jau4 piu3.) “I used to collect stamps when I was younger.” |
3. 寄信 (gei3 seon3) “to mail a letter; to post a letter” |
我寄信畀你。 (ngo5 gei3 seon3 bei2 nei5.) “I mail a letter to you.” |
而家好少人寄信,通常都係電郵。 (ji4 gaa1 hou2 siu2 jan4 gei3 seon3, tung1 soeng4 dou1 hai6 din6 jau4.) “Nowadays, most people don't mail letters; they send emails.” |
4. 信封 (seon3 fung1) “envelope” |
信 (seon3 ) is “letter” and 封 (fung1) is “enclosement” so enclosing the letter is the “envelope” 信封 (seon3 fung1). |
我冇信封呀,你可唔可以畀一個我呀? (ngo5 mou5 seon3 fung1 aa3, nei5 ho2 m4 ho2 ji5 bei2 jat1 go3 ngo5 aa3?) “I don't have an envelope, can you give me one?” |
5. 速遞 (cuk1 dai6) “express mail” |
速 (cuk1) is like “rapid or fast”, 遞 (dai6) is “to handover” so a very fast handover is express. |
呢份文件我趕住要,所以要send速遞呀。 (ni1 fan6 man4 gin2 ngo5 gon2 zyu6 jiu3, so2 ji3 jiu3 SEND cuk1 dai6 aa3.) “I need this document urgently, so please send it by express mail.” |
